Courses from 1000+ universities
Seven years after replacing a Yale president with a fintech CEO, Coursera picks an Amazon veteran to help fix its slowing growth and falling stock price.
600 Free Google Certifications
Data Analysis
Project Management
Graphic Design
Critical Perspectives on Management
Design Patterns
Supporting Victims of Domestic Violence
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n Delegates, earn certificates with paid and free online courses from University of Michigan, Henan University and other top universities around the world. Read reviews to decide if a class is right for you.
How do you handle events that occur in your application using C#? What are delegates and how and why would you use them? In this course, C# Events, Delegates, and Lambdas, you’ll learn what events, delegates, and lambdas are and how you can use them. F…
Explore function pointers, delegates, and callbacks in C++. Learn the delegate-callback pattern, its implementation, and practical applications using C++Builder for visualization.
Master the confusing C# constructs: Events, Delegates, Lambda Expressions, LINQ, Async/Await and more!
Learn C# by doing | C# projects | Bootcamp for C# Interview | Advanced C# | Collections | LINQ | Interview Questions
Learn advanced topics of the C# language like LINQ, Lambda, Extension Methods, Generics, Delegates, Events and more!
Become an Advanced WPF Developer Who Can Handle XAML and Code Behind in His/Her Sleep And Build Beautiful GUIs
Master the Fundamentals and Level Up Your C# Programming Skills Quickly and Easily!
Learn how to work with Apple's fun new language "Swift", and go from a newbie to transforming your ideas into real apps
Learn the basics of creating an iOS application in C# with Xamarin
Master advanced C# in .NET Core: language features, OOP techniques, data access, and error handling. Enhance coding skills, design scalable applications, optimize databases, and create robust software.
Master advanced C# techniques with C# Programming Level 2: Advanced Programming Techniques.
Master advanced C# techniques and deepen your Windows application development skills through hands-on training.
Master advanced C#, ASP.NET Core, testing, and scalable application design. Elevate your .NET Core expertise with hands-on learning in web development, debugging, and high-performance architecture.
When building applications we often deal with groups of things: a user's preferences, a customer's orders, or a product's color choices. To implement these groups of things in C#, we use collections. And to get the most from collections, we need to lev…
Learn the basic concepts of .NET, that foundational programming platform in the Microsoft developer ecosystem.
Get personalized course recommendations, track subjects and courses with reminders, and more.